Inspiration
Many students struggle to maintain focus and manage tasks using multiple disconnected tools, which often leads to distraction and reduced productivity. PrepCore was created to solve this problem by offering a unified platform that simplifies study workflows, helping learners build discipline, track progress, and stay motivated through a single, focused app.
What It Does
PrepCore brings together three core features:
- Smart Focus Timer
- Intuitive Task Manager
- AI-Powered Q&A Assistant (Groq-based)
With PrepCore, students can:
- Plan structured study sessions
- Manage tasks and deadlines efficiently
- Get instant AI help for doubts and concepts
- Track study streaks
- View analytics to improve consistency and productivity
How We Built It
- Frontend: React + TypeScript
- UI: Tailwind CSS
- Backend: Supabase (authentication + database)
- AI: Groq API for real-time, context-aware assistance
Challenges We Ran Into
- Maintaining simplicity while including multiple productivity features
- Optimizing AI responses for speed and accuracy
- Handling real-time interactions and data syncing
- Ensuring consistent responsiveness across devices
Accomplishments We're Proud Of
- Created a unified productivity tool with focus, tasks, and AI support
- Delivered a smooth, intuitive UI within a tight hackathon timeline
- Integrated real-time AI features successfully
- Developed clean workflows and robust full-stack architecture
What We Learned
- Importance of user-centric and distraction-free design
- Integrating Supabase with modern frontend frameworks
- Enabling real-time interaction using AI APIs
- Improved full-stack development skills
What's Next for PrepCore
- Collaborative group study rooms
- More advanced personalized AI tutoring
- Deeper analytics and insights
- Better cross-device syncing and smart notifications
Built With
- groq
- javascript
- react
- sql
- supabase
- tailwind
- typescript
Log in or sign up for Devpost to join the conversation.